Not for x64 Tech Level: high Ownership: 1 day to 1 week This user purchased this item from Newegg
Pros: Looks good. Comes in a high quality box.
Cons: Incompatible with x64 operating systems. Atech's tech support claims there is "no demand" for x64 drivers. Save yourself the restocking fee if you use Vista x64.

. Tech Level: average Ownership: 1 month to 1 year This user purchased this item from Newegg
Pros: Sturdy construction and has good versitility. The unit is compatible with both Windows and Mac. The mac needs no drivers either.
Cons: none
Other Thoughts: We have a mac and pc's at our home. One of the pc's and mac share the unit. We look for add-on devices such as this that can be used for both.
